Study Notes

Reference Points in Motion

  • Reference point for Tyler's trip is Atlanta, establishing the starting point for measuring distance.
  • The diver likely used the ocean surface as a reference point to describe the squid's position.

Velocity and Speed

  • The x-axis of a velocity graph is labeled "Time," while the y-axis is labeled "Velocity."
  • Slope of the position vs time graph is used to calculate an object's velocity.
  • Displacement must be described with both measurement and direction.

Acceleration

  • Positive acceleration occurs when an object increases its speed.
  • Distinctions in acceleration can be clarified by comparing velocities over time; Finley has the least, followed by Xander, then Max with the most.

Travel Time and Speed Calculations

  • Koto's travel time, given her velocity of 4.5 m/s, is calculated to be 18.5 minutes based on her travel distance.
  • Kai's round trip covers 200 meters in 200 seconds, yielding a speed of 2 m/s, while his velocity is 0 since he returns to his starting point.

Motion Analysis via Graphs

  • Carla's velocity vs. time graph indicates she slowed down initially, stopped, and then accelerated again, illustrating changes in motion dynamics throughout her trip.

Key Concepts in Motion

  • Understanding motion involves concepts of reference points, speed, velocity, acceleration, and displacement.
  • Both speed and velocity are essential for analyzing an object's movement, but they differ in that velocity includes direction.
